Research Support Assistant
Required Qualifications: (as evidenced by an attached resume) Associate degree (foreign equivalent or higher) in Biology, Chemistry, or a related field completed before employment. Hands-on experience in a biomedical research laboratory. Preferred Qualifications: Bachelor's degree (foreign equivalent or higher) in Biology, Chemistry, or a related field. One [1], or more, years of research experience. Experience with molecular biology techniques such as plasmid purification, PCR, gel electrophoresis, and bacterial culture. Brief Description of Duties: The Gunn Lab at Stony Brook University is seeking a Research Support Assistant to perform research related to pancreatic lipase. The Gunn Lab studies the structure of metabolic enzymes from the pancreas using techniques from biochemistry, biophysics, and cell biology. The Research Support Assistant will conduct research under the direction of the PI, which will include tissue culture, protein purification, electron microscopy, and activity assays. The Research Support Assistant will also help set up and maintain the lab supplies and organization. Please see for more information about the lab's research and environment.
